新聞中心
Redis集群構(gòu)建起來的復(fù)雜程度讓許多企業(yè)擔(dān)心自己不具備實(shí)施該系統(tǒng)的能力。但是現(xiàn)在,技術(shù)的發(fā)展讓人們重新考慮Redis集群,并且發(fā)揮其『in memory』(內(nèi)存)儲(chǔ)存高速訪問功能。Redis是一款高性能的開源數(shù)據(jù)庫(kù),用戶可以將其當(dāng)做緩存或主存儲(chǔ),通過客戶端/服務(wù)器模式,支持存儲(chǔ),檢索和操作數(shù)據(jù)。

Redis集群的模式允許它通過增加服務(wù)器節(jié)點(diǎn)的數(shù)量來擴(kuò)展可用的內(nèi)存儲(chǔ)存空間,并且可以滿足企業(yè)規(guī)模的數(shù)據(jù)性能需求。Redis集群的建立,可以構(gòu)建一個(gè)分布式的、容錯(cuò)能力非常強(qiáng)的『master-slave』(主-從)結(jié)構(gòu),以及可用于存儲(chǔ)實(shí)時(shí)搜索引擎,全文件搜索引擎,NoSQL數(shù)據(jù)庫(kù)和計(jì)算服務(wù)等應(yīng)用程序的『sharding』(分片)機(jī)制。
與其他數(shù)據(jù)庫(kù)相比,Redis集群的優(yōu)勢(shì)主要在于它可以在多個(gè)實(shí)例間共享大量的數(shù)據(jù),能夠更有效地傳輸數(shù)據(jù)和執(zhí)行數(shù)據(jù)庫(kù)操作,在高吞吐量的情況下運(yùn)行大量的事務(wù),還可以讓用戶通過更少的服務(wù)器來實(shí)現(xiàn)更高的處理能力。
另外,Redis集群還可以支持『high avlability』(高可用性)功能,可以在故障發(fā)生時(shí)自動(dòng)轉(zhuǎn)移服務(wù),避免數(shù)據(jù)在短時(shí)間內(nèi)丟失。此外,Redis集群還擁有強(qiáng)大的安全性,可以使用『TLS』(傳輸層安全),『AES』(高級(jí)加密標(biāo)準(zhǔn))等加密技術(shù)來確保企業(yè)數(shù)據(jù)的安全性,同時(shí)用戶也可以自行設(shè)置訪問控制權(quán)限,來管理Redis的訪問。
由于Redis的訪問速度要快于關(guān)系數(shù)據(jù)庫(kù),可以支持大量的查詢,高興可用性,安全性等特性,多個(gè)企業(yè)正在重新考慮將Redis集群建設(shè)成他們主要的數(shù)據(jù)庫(kù),特別是那些需要處理復(fù)雜數(shù)據(jù)的企業(yè)。
如果你想實(shí)現(xiàn)Redis集群,你可以采用官方提供的工具,根據(jù)說明書即可安裝Redis的集群,其中『redis-trib.rb』是用來構(gòu)建Redis集群的實(shí)用工具,你可以通過ruby腳本運(yùn)行這個(gè)工具,安裝Redis的集群,此外,你還可以使用Docker容器,簡(jiǎn)化Redis的部署、配置和維護(hù),以及通過Kubernetes管理Redis集群,從而使企業(yè)可以更加便利地管理Redis集群。
綜上,Redis集群不但可以在單一服務(wù)器上提高性能,還可以通過它的分布式服務(wù)來管理和優(yōu)化企業(yè)數(shù)據(jù),因此,如果你想要提高企業(yè)數(shù)據(jù)處理能力,建立Redis集群是很有必要的,為你打開另一扇通往企業(yè)數(shù)據(jù)自動(dòng)化的大門。
成都網(wǎng)站建設(shè)選創(chuàng)新互聯(lián)(?:028-86922220),專業(yè)從事成都網(wǎng)站制作設(shè)計(jì),高端小程序APP定制開發(fā),成都網(wǎng)絡(luò)營(yíng)銷推廣等一站式服務(wù)。
網(wǎng)站欄目:Redis集群重新開始(redis集群搭重啟)
文章網(wǎng)址:http://fisionsoft.com.cn/article/dhoecdd.html


咨詢
建站咨詢
